Finance & Accounting Business Systems Analyst Consultant
Our consultancy is looking for highly motivated and talented Business Systems Analysts Consultants with a finance/accounting background. We are looking for peak performers who have a passion for business, a joy in solving problems and a work ethic that doesn't rest until the job is done.
Ideal candidates would possess 5-10 years of business systems analysis experience in a finance/accounting environment, with insurance industry experience a plus.  Candidates should have a strong familiarity with Process Flow Diagramming as well as Six Sigma and process standardization/improvement experience.  Candidates should have a strong comfort level with working with and analyzing large sets of data, as well as solid organizational and requirements elicitation skills.  We are looking for candidates with a strong finance knowledge and a working knowledge of GAAP standards.  Ideal candidates will have exceptional interpersonal, verbal communication and presentation/storytelling skills to be able to help facilitate elicitation and read-out sessions with the project leadership team.  Additionally, candidates should have excellent relationship-building skills to build trust and facilitate shared understanding and buy-in with business process owners.  A client service focus, as well as the ability to identify opportunities for improvement, develop recommendations and implement complex solutions in a fast-paced environment are key.
Some of the key systems this person may be working with include VRC’s Velocity or Verity Systems, Kyriba, Blackline, Prism and Accounting Center ,the Workday Financial Management platform, InsCipher, and AMS360.  
P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Interviewing stakeholders from different profit centers to identify current state finance workflows.
  • Review workflows including invoicing, cash application, AR processing, AP procurement and management, monthly close and reporting, treasury management, etc.
  • Requirements gathering.
REQUIRED SKILLS
  •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field.
  • Business Systems Analysis experience in finance/accounting.
  • Strong finance knowledge and a working knowledge of GAAP standards.
  • Business Systems Analysis experience working in the insurance industry a plus.
  • BSA experience, including requirements gathering and documentation.
  • Process flow diagramming experience, MS Visio experience preferred.
  • Six Sigma and process standardization/improvement experience a plus.
  • Demonstrated experience working with and analyzing large sets of data. 
  • Strong facilitation skills, and solid verbal and written communication skills.
  • Strong Word and PowerPoint skills.
  • Strong Excel skills, including familiarity working with a large dataset and getting useful insights out of it.
  • Strong relationship building between internal customers, vendors and employees.
  • Client-facing experience.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
